Output 868a76c3a96a337230cde1f651fc74e5ce63c0b78d3ef9745cf68991cc7bd84a:4

value
25784178
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14356754a56b331cb786078a12ce7add61fbea2f OP_EQUALVERIFY OP_CHECKSIG
address
12qrVPQKai9S22LPzfa7fXGbReJCbdFHGd
transaction
868a76c3a96a337230cde1f651fc74e5ce63c0b78d3ef9745cf68991cc7bd84a
spent
true